– Change the language in Google Chrome: detailed instructions
Introduction to language change in Google Chrome: Change language in Google Chrome It is a simple task that will allow you to enjoy a personalized browsing experience. This feature is especially useful if you prefer to use the browser in your native language or if you want to explore other languages to familiarize yourself with them. Below you will find detailed instructions on how to change the language in Google Chrome.
Step 1: Access Chrome settings: To get started, open Google Chrome on your computer and click on the three vertical dots icon located in the upper right corner of the screen. Next, from the drop-down menu, select the “Settings” option. This will take you to the Chrome settings page, where you can modify various browser options.
Step 2: Find the language section: Once on thesettings page, scroll down until you find the “Languages” section. In this section, you will be able to see the language currently selected in Google Chrome. To make the change, click on the “Languages” link located to the right of the current language.
Step 3: Change the language: By clicking on the “Languages” link, a new window will open where you can add or remove languages according to your preferences. Click the “Add Languages” button to select a new language from the drop-down list. After selecting the desired language, be sure to drag it up to set it as your primary language. If you want to remove a language from the list, simply select the language and click the “Delete” button represented by the trash icon. Once the modifications have been made, close the window and the new language will be automatically applied in Google Chrome.

– Recommendations to solve problems when changing the language on Google
Recommendations for solve problems when changing the language in Google
When we try to change the language on Google, sometimes we may experience some problems. However, don't worry, here are some technical recommendations to solve them.
1. Make sure you have the latest version from Google Chrome: It is important to keep your browser updated to avoid possible errors. To check if you have the latest version, simply click on the three-dot menu in the top right corner of the Chrome window and select “Settings.” Then, in the left sidebar, select “Help” and click “About Google Chrome”. If an update is available, the download will automatically start.
2. Clear your browser's cache and cookies: Accumulation of data in cache and cookies may interfere with language switching functionality. To fix this, go to Chrome's settings and select “Privacy & Security” in the left sidebar. Then, click “Clear browsing data” and select “Cache” and “Cookies and other site data.” Make sure you select “All the time” from the drop-down menu and then click “Clear data.”
3. Check the language settings in your Google account: Sometimes the problem may be related to the language settings in your Google account. To fix this, sign in to your Google account, click your profile photo in the top right corner, and select “Manage your Google account.” Then, go to the “Data & Personalization” tab and look for the “General Language Preferences” section. Make sure the desired language is selected, and if not, click Edit to make the necessary changes.
